For the second time this year, Carolina Panthers running back DeAngelo Williams has been nominated to receive the Fed Ex Ground player of the week award. Williams’ 108 yards and a touchdown help lead the Carolina Panthers to a decisive victory over the Arizona Cardinals for the fifth 100-yard game of his career. Williams is up against Brian Westbrook and Clinton Portis, both of whom have better numbers, but neither of them converted a 3rd and 13 to win their ballgames.
It seems that Williams is finnaly comming into his own. Many thought the the drafting of Jonathan Stewart singaled that Williams would eventually lose his starting job. Williams was able to hold his spot as the Panther’s number one back during training camp though, and has had a breakout year, showing vast improvment from his previous two seasons. Williams should have some good games ahead as well, with the Panthers facing Okland and Detroit in their next two games, who rank 27th and 31st agaisnt the rush respectively.
